Spend 45 million as a spare tire? Tottenham buys out Terr 35 million this summer, players are not selected for the Champions League roster
The new season of the Champions League is about to begin, and each team has announced its own registration list one after another. German media "Sports Pictures" has included the stars who missed the Champions League roster. Most of them are due to injuries, but some players are due to registration rules and competitive status. Totel: Terl, Kulusevski (injury), Dragusin (injury), Madison (injury), Bisuma... Liverpool: Chiesa Jr. Arsenal: Jesus (injury) Leverkusen: Hoffman (injury), Terrier (injury) Among them, Tottenham bought out Terl from Bayern this summer. According to previous reports from Romano, Terl's transfer fee structure is: 35 million euros fixed fee + 5 million euros floating clause, and there is also a 10 million euro loan fee in the winter window (paid). Tottenham will pay a total of 45-50 million euros to Bayern.
